1. Aim
Based upon the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) between Japan Association for Bioethics (JAB) and American Society for Bioethics and Humanities (ASBH), the JAB-ASBH Fellowship Fund, which is paid by JAB, invites one of ASBH’s members to attend the annual JAB conference for the purpose of enhancing international exchange and collaboration between ASBH and JAB members.
2. Intended conference
The 37th Annual JAB Conference 2025 will be held on November 22nd and 23rd, 2025 at Morioka Civic Cultural Hall (3-minutes walk from JR Morioka Station using the East-West Free Passage (Sansa Komichi).Map URL: https://maps.app.goo.gl/eYMyJd5VwweVccXu8) and Iwate University of Health and Medical Science (5-minute walk from JR Morioka Station West Exit, and it is next to Aiina which is the Iwate Prefecture Citizens’ Cultural Exchange Center, Google map: https://maps.app.goo.gl/kMk9NSGVS9nHkAsFA) located in Iwate Prefecture.
3. Application Requirements and conditions
To be eligible for the JAB-ASBH Fellowship Fund, applicants must meet the following requirements and agree in writing to the following conditions.
- Applicants must be current ASBH members in good standing.
- All ASBH members are eligible, but special consideration will be given to those who received their doctorate or professional degree within the past 5 years.
- Along with the application form, applicants must submit an abstract for the 37th Annual JAB Conference 2025 by the due date (details are in session 7 “Submission and deadline” below).
- By submitting the application form, applicants agree to maintain ASBH membership through the end-date of the JAB conference, present a paper and chair a 2-3 hours session in English at the same JAB conference, and submit a short report (500 words limit) within 30 days of the conference’s ending. (Per the MOU, ASBH will verify ASBH membership of applicants.)
- All applicants will be reviewed either solely by the JAB’s existing committee for international collaboration, or jointly by the JAB’s existing committee for international and a selected member of ASBH. The Fund will be granted to one applicant only.
4. Amount of JAB-ASBH Fellowship Fund and Payment
- The awardee of the JAB-ASBH Fellowship Fund will be paid the actual expenses up to a maximum of 300,000 JPY (approximately 2,000 USD depending on exchange rates).
- The fund will be paid in cash to the awardee following completion of participation at the JAB conference with a signed receipt by the awardee.
- The fund is designated for purpose of reimburses expenses associated with preparing for and attending the 37th Annual JAB Conference 2025, including: 1) travel expenses (flight and ground transportation), 2) accommodation at the conference venue in Morioka and travel expenses to Morioka, Iwate, 3) international travel insurance fee, 4) other necessary expenses related to participation at the intended conference at the approval of JAB’s international committee. Note that the booking of flights and accommodations etc. should be made by the awardee himself/herself. The awardee is required to submit the above receipts (receipts can be sent by email in PDF format).
- The JAB conference registration fee will be waived.
5. Obligation of Awardee
The awardee of the JAB-ASBH Fellowship Fund is obliged to:
- Present a 20 minutes paper at the 37th Annual JAB Conference 2025 in English.
- Chair a 2-3 hour session in English at the same JAB conference, including speaker introductions and moderating the session and Q&A, and posing questions for each speaker when necessary.
- Submit a short report (500-word limit) to the ASBH Board of Directors and the JAB Boards of Director within 30 days after the conference’s end. The report should indicate how the experience attending the JAB conference might be useful for the awardee’s future research, teaching, or other professional activities.
6. Selection Policy
Evaluation of applicants will be based on the caliber of the submitted abstract, and its relevance to attendees at a future JAB conference. In addition, high marks will be granted for original and well-reasoned submission.
7. Submission and deadline
- Applicants must submit the application form including an abstract of 300-500 words. https://forms.gle/6F8hbZVkRXmiJrbt7
- The submission deadline is 23:59 JST Sunday, June 15th, 2025.
- All application forms will be reviewed either solely by the committee for international collaboration of JAB, or jointly by the committee for international collaboration of JAB and a selected member of ASBH. The review process will be completed within 30 days after the submission deadline. Upon approval of the JAB Board of Directors, the selection committee will directly notify the result to the ASBH Board first, and then the applicant. Notification to applicants will occur in writing following ASBH Board notification. JAB aims to provide applicant notification within 2 months from the submission deadline.
